Mr. Prepper - Animal Farm DLC expands the core survival simulation experience of the base game into farm management and animal care on PC. This single-player title blends action, indie, RPG, casual, simulation, and adventure elements as players prepare an underground shelter while handling new responsibilities at a local farm.
Gameplay
The central loop revolves around resource management, crafting, and exploration while maintaining low suspicion from the Agency. Players repair farm facilities, tend to animals through breeding and daily care routines, and learn fishing at a nearby lake. These activities yield new ingredients such as milk and grain seeds that feed into shelter recipes and production systems.
Integration with the main shelter comes through animal-related structures including fences, enclosures, feeders, and pallets. New decoration options like aquaria add visual variety to living spaces. A fresh storyline layer introduces surveillance themes, mysterious abductions, and mind control elements that tie into the farm's operations and broader narrative progression.
Exploration expands to a dedicated farm area, lake zone, and a mysterious crop labyrinth where players uncover additional resources and story details. Trading and quest completion remain key, now supported by farm outputs that generate new products for barter or personal use.

Key Features and Mechanics
Animal breeding and care introduce ongoing maintenance tasks that produce usable goods like milk for new recipes. Grain seeds expand planting options and support both farm output and shelter food production. These systems connect directly to existing crafting loops without requiring separate progression paths.
New shelter items focus on practical animal infrastructure that improves efficiency and organization. The storyline additions emphasize investigation and discovery, encouraging players to balance farm duties with uncovering hidden elements above ground.
